Transaction 9870683a3a77ae5020613769be5ad4afdb1a95759161e70078311b147851ed3a
1 Input
1 Output
-
9870683a3a77ae5020613769be5ad4afdb1a95759161e70078311b147851ed3a:0
- value
- 1001912
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e581c5dbbb70d13e3fa98b36f8440b231f35ba8f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MvXCi27ekC52eXCPaioDxM52HbFemvXiE